Oil production in pre-revolutionary Russia and the struggle over petroleum markets

Leonid E. Shepelev

No 781, Working Papers from Graduate School of Management, St. Petersburg State University

Abstract: The talk examines the conditions of oil production in pre-revolutionary Russia, the structure of oil-producing and refining firms is identified, the conditions of petroleum products sales in the late XIXth-early XXth centuries are characterized. The talk is based on the material of office work records of petroleum companies and governmental institutions of the mining department of the Russian Empire kept at the state archives in Russia, Azerbaijan and Georgia.
